After breakfast, you will be driven to Balapitiya (Approx. 3 hrs.’ drive). Do a river safari at Madu Ganga. Located in Balapitiya, Madu Ganga is famous for its unique mangrove vegetation lines and caves. A relatively unspoiled lagoon, the Madu Ganga estuary is a 915-hectare complex coastal wetland ecosystem that opens to the Indian Ocean. In this boat trip, you can see kraal-fishing constructions and fishermen making their way in rowing boats to collect their day's catch. Worship at temple island, fish therapy and visit to a cinnamon island are some of the activities you do during this boat ride. On completion of this visit, you will be able to visit a Turtle hatchery in Kosgoda. Kosgoda is famous for its sea turtle conservation project operated by the Wild Life Protection Society of Sri Lanka. The hatchery buries the eggs in the sand, and when they hatch around 50 days later the baby turtles are released into the sea at night. Turtle hatchery also has tanks for injured or disabled turtles, including albino turtles that would not survive in the sea. After this visit, you will be taken to Mirissa. After breakfast, you will be transferred to Mirissa fishery harbor where you will start a whale watching tour. Mirissa is one of best places in the world to see Blue Whales and Sperm Whales on the same sailing. You will have a better chance of seeing these incredible animals during their annual migration from November to April when continental shelf is narrow to the South of Dondra. In addition to the whales, dolphins, and turtles are also seen in this area. Here you can witness Blue whales, Bryde´s whales, Sperm whales, Fin whales, sometimes Killer whales, and Common Dolphins, Bottlenose dolphins, Spinner Dolphins, Risso's Dolphins and Striped Dolphins with a bit of luck. Known as Little England, the town of Nuwara Eliya enjoys spring-like weather throughout the year. A favorite retreat of the British during colonial times, the town is dotted with English country style houses and half-timbered bungalows. During this tour, you will visit Victoria Park, Gregory Lake, 19th century Golf Club and drive around the city. Kandy, also Known as the hill capital or Hill country, is the last stronghold of Sinhalese kings after Portuguese, Dutch and British ruling periods. To the Buddhists of Sri Lanka and the World, Kandy is one of the most sacred sites as it is the home of the Temple of the Sacred Tooth Relic of Lord Buddha. The upper lake drive is more scenic and memorable. Today Kandy is the center of Buddhism, Arts, Crafts, Dancing, Music and Culture.
